Most common Honda Xl 650 v-6 MOT faults

These are the faults and advisories recorded most often across Honda Xl 650 v-6 MOT tests:

  1. Rear Tyre worn close to the legal limit (4.1.3(ii)) (128 times)
  2. Front Tyre worn close to the legal limit (4.1.3(ii)) (89 times)
  3. Rear Brake pad(s) close to minimum limit (3.2.A1f(i)) (62 times)
  4. Drive chain slightly loose (6.2.1d) (51 times)
  5. Steering movement slightly 'notchy' (2.2.1b) (51 times)
  6. Front Brake indicates slight fluctuation of brake effort (1.2.1 (e)) (50 times)
  7. Front Roller brake test indicates slight fluctuation of brake effort (3.3.A1d) (50 times)
  8. Drive chain worn but not considered excessive (6.2.1e) (43 times)
  9. Front Brake binding but not excessively (1.2.1 (f)) (37 times)
  10. Rear T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m (4.1.3(ii)) (36 times)
  11. Rear Roller brake test indicates slight fluctuation of brake effort (3.3.A1d) (36 times)
  12. Drive chain slightly loose (6.1.7 (c) (i)) (32 times)
  13. Front Roller brake test indicates a binding brake (3.3.A1a) (32 times)
  14. Rear Tyre worn close to the legal limit (5.2.3 (e)) (29 times)
  15. Front Tyre worn close to the legal limit (5.2.3 (e)) (27 times)
